Frisco, TX: A Hotspot for Renovations and Capital Improvements

According to recent reports, 2025 is setting new records for construction activity in Frisco. The city is experiencing:

  • Record permit issuances for commercial renovations, design-build projects, and capital upgrades (Texas Contractor News).
  • High demand for energy-efficient systems, ADA compliance, and infrastructure resilience—key selling points for modernized properties.
  • A significant shift towards certified property condition assessments and independent contractor audits, ensuring every dollar invested translates to real value (CBRE).

Frisco’s real estate surge means developers need construction partners that not only build, but also consult. The right team helps maximize asset value by identifying the smartest upgrade strategies—whether through capital improvements, rapid room turns, or full-scale renovations.

Frisco’s boom comes with its challenges:

  • Rising Costs: Construction pricing ranges from $350–$800+ per square foot for complex projects, driven by skilled labor demand and technical requirements (Maxx Builders).
  • Labor Shortages: Early contractor selection and experienced teams are critical for staying on schedule (Global Construction).
  • Tough Inspections: Frisco’s emphasis on certified third-party assessments and contractor audits rewards developers who choose trusted, process-driven partners (Frisco City News).
